Kherson region's educational institutions introduce entrepreneurship training

(PHOTO: Generated by AI.)

In the 2025-2026 academic year, six educational institutions in Kherson region have implemented an international entrepreneurship training program from Junior Achievement Ukraine.

This is stated in the press release of Junior Achievement Ukraine.

The program will run throughout the academic year and is completely free for both students and teachers. It covers practical skills in planning, marketing, financial literacy, and teamwork, allowing students to create and run their own educational business projects. In addition to teachers, local entrepreneurs can serve as mentors.

The international organization Junior Achievement, which supports this initiative, has been operating globally since 1919 and reaches more than 15 million students in more than 100 countries. In Ukraine, its educational projects are implemented with the support of the Ministry of Education and Science and annually involve more than 10 thousand young people.

Meanwhile, rumors of a region-wide quarantine in schools have been denied in Odesa. The temporary transition of some institutions to distance learning is only related to the increased incidence of SARS and is a preventive measure.

According to the press service, rumors have recently been spreading on social media that the CDC is allegedly introducing a region-wide quarantine. The center's press service emphasizes that no such statements have been made. The temporary transition to distance learning in some institutions is only associated with an increase in the incidence of SARS and is a common preventive measure.
